Definitions:

Amygdala

A set of neurons located deep in the brain's medial temporal lobe, playing key roles in the processing of emotions.

Thalamus

The forebrain structure that sits at the top of the brain stem in the brain’s central core and serves as an important relay station.

Two-factor Theory

The Two-factor Theory proposes that human emotions are the result of a combination of physiological arousal and the cognitive labeling of that arousal.

Drive Reduction Theory

A motivational theory proposing that the maintenance of homeostasis motivates behavior that reduces drives arising from physiological needs.
